### Changelog — CatalogueBridge 4.2.0

Defaults changed for the Wrenfield Library import pipeline. Previously, MARC record batches were capped at 500 and duplicate ISBNs were silently skipped; both behaviors caused missed updates during the Ashcombe branch migration. Batches now default to 2000 with explicit duplicate reporting, and the retry window was widened to tolerate slow catalogue mirrors. Reviewers should verify downstream consumers handle the larger payloads. The new default configuration shipped with this release is listed below.

settings of tagef-bawif:
DRUIX_HOST=druix.zemvarlabs.internal
DRUIX_PORT=8000

- Door sensor recall: the Hallix-brand sensors on the east wing doors at Corvan Labs are being replaced this month. Some doors won't unlock on a badge tap alone, so don't assume your badge has failed. Until the swap is complete, new starters should enter via the lobby turnstiles using the temporary code below.

door code, tahop-fahap: bdg-JZCXMY-37375484

## Env Vars: Doclint (Quillbarrow)

For the eng sync: the doc linter runs on every merge to `main`. Relevant vars: `DOCLINT_RULESET=strict`, `DOCLINT_FAIL_ON_WARN=false`. Flip the latter only with team agreement. Lint reports are pushed to the internal metrics sink, which requires the publishing credential that the env file sets on the line directly below.

secret setting of hawep-yahig: LEDGER_TOKEN29=41b5d6315371c92885eaeb077fb63

Subject: Key rotation for InvoiceForge renderer

Welcome, new folks. Every quarter we rotate the credential the Pellworth PDF invoice renderer uses to call our internal asset service, Vaultline. The old key stops working Friday at noon. Update your local .env and the staging config before then, and verify a test invoice renders with the new embedded fonts. For convenience, the freshly issued key is included here.

app token of bagef-bageg = kto11_vuwA0uhrEMg